Transaction ae62e089f771187e55b8eab2376ec01bf81992581010a838c7353fa2fa3748f0

3 Input
2 Outputs
  • ae62e089f771187e55b8eab2376ec01bf81992581010a838c7353fa2fa3748f0:0
  • value  75000000
    address  1CwJhgxorNHv2aY3NsF4CQGwJxyggHkV2X
  • ae62e089f771187e55b8eab2376ec01bf81992581010a838c7353fa2fa3748f0:1
  • value  34066
    address  1PdPMQ5cfCUd8UY97wchhenJG6rokBSELp